Taxonomic Classification

Rank Broad-headed Chiruromys oak yellow underwing
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Muridae (Mice & Rats) Erebidae
Genus Chiruromys Catocala
Species Chiruromys lamia Catocala nymphagoga

Evolutionary Relationship

Broad-headed Chiruromys and oak yellow underwing share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
